Clans in Turmoil: The Jacobite Era
This chapter examines the turbulent history of Scottish clans from the aftermath of the Massacre of Glencoe to the Battle of Culloden, focusing on clan loyalties amidst the Jacobite risings. It highlights the internal conflicts, religious tensions, and shifting dynamics that led to the dissolution of clan culture. Ultimately, the chapter discusses the severe aftermath of the Battle of Culloden and the sweeping changes that followed, reshaping Scottish identity and society.
